ansys 14.5 linux 安装教程,linux 安装 ansys14 - 计算模拟 - 小木虫 - 学术 科研 互动社区...

Ansys14.0 安装简明教程

首先查看系统的版本,如果系统在6.1以上,网卡的名字应该被改变,eth0变成em1 这个时候需要把网卡的名字改成eth0,否则

ansys将无法正确读取mac地址,读取出来的将会是12个0.。切记,一个和两个网卡其实无所谓,只要注意点配置文件和ansys读取的mac地址是匹配的就可以。

网卡这个事情我估计14.0之前的所有版本如果安装在6.1以上的系统都会出现这种问题吧,没试过。

其二可以开始安装ansys了,首先先安装ansys_admin授权管理应用,就是第一张光盘里面运行./INSTALL.LM 文件,两个没有先后随自己喜欢,我个人的爱好,正常安装

没什么可说的,下一步就可以了,最后会让指定license文件,可以退出以后再安装,我选择退出,安装完授权管理以后。就先

开始配置这个授权管理吧,,ansys自身带了一个友好的界面管理,我不太喜欢用,太麻烦,乱七八糟的错误一堆。所以我还是喜欢

命令行来管理,我建议你们也用命令行吧,否则没有经验的人去安装这个软件,能把你折磨疯了。

安装完以后 软件的默认目录应该是在/ansys_inc  这个是它自己创建的快捷方式

通过命令进入/ansys_inc/shared_files/licensing 下面

这个目录下面有些配置文件,你可以吧你生成的license放入这个下面,license放进来以后 进行下一步

在进入 lic_admin 目录里面运行 ./anslic_admin  这个命令是启动图形界面,你可以先启动一下看看里面的3个服务是不是都没有

运行,,这里可以简单的配置一些信息。首先 启动这个界面,命令是./anslic_admin

先选择Display the license Server Machine hostid 这项

查看你得主机名和你得mac地址,这里一定不要弄错,这是关键,这里的东西一定要和你得license一致

Hostname:后面就是你得电脑名字

FlexID:后面就是你得mac地址,如果这里面全部是0的话,就回到我刚开始时候说的那样做,把你得网卡名字改一下

查看网卡的名字用命令 ifconfig 就可以看到了。

这个界面的左下角是这个软件3个服务的状态,现在没配置,应该全是not running

如果这里面有任何的服务没有起来你都应该想到用命令行来操作了,不在用这个友好界面了。

现在选择左面的 Specify the license Server Machine选项

会出现一个界面

我得说一下 很多人在这就犯愁输入不进去,特别是我这个电脑,用的是无线鼠标

在其他电脑可以用鼠标的中建进行粘贴,我的鼠标就不行,在网上也找了一些配置

不知道是我配置不对还是怎样就是不好用,无奈之下想到一个办法,如果你也我一样

那么就用下面的方法吧。选择Add Server Machine Specification选项

进行添加吧,上面的端口默认都已经填上了

主要是填hostname1  就这个地方我的电脑无法添加

其实填完保存以后会在,licensing目录生成一个配置文件,你可以直接建立这个文件的

就不需要再这里无谓的挣扎了

OK 我这个就不添加了,因为我无法使用粘贴,全部关掉回到上层目录就是licensing目录,在这个目录下面开始建立一个配置文件

名字叫"ansyslmd.ini"  (-rwxr-xr-x 这个是我文件的权限,这句话可以无视)应该是随便吧,不太了解,实在不好用的时候才会去研究这些不着边际的小问题,现在无所谓去弄他了,打开这个配置文件

里面的内容这样输入

server=1055@linux  ##这是注释不要填进去,1055是端口 linux 是你得主机名,要根据你得实际去填别和我的一样

ansysli_servers=2325@linux  #同样 这个2325也是端口 linux也是你得主机名

保存退出就可以了

这两行你们应该能看明白是什么意思吧,哎,费点口水吧,估计还是有人不明白,明白的略过吧

填完以后你们还是检查一下,就是打开你得授权配置界面 去这步Add Server Machine Specification选项 去查看吧

看看计算机名是不是已经上去了

我这截不了图 真是烦呀

好了 去生成你得license吧 生成以后打开你的license文件 把第一行 server 后面替换你的计算机名字  后面空几个格子 在填上你的网卡的mac地址 端口是1055 OK保存吧,好像是说重复了,对付看吧,实在没什么时间检查了,还有工作要做。

把这个license文件复制到 licensing的目录下面

全部都OK了 就开始用命令启动吧

进入/ansys_inc/shared_files/licensing/linx64 这个目录

输入./lmgrd -c ../license.dat -l ../license.log   # 参数-c 是指定你的license.dat文件位置,可以用绝对路径 -l 是日志文件保存的位置,和日志的文件名字。

ok 如果不报错 就去看看日志文件,看看是不是报错

tail -f ../license.log  查看日志  这个命令是自动更新日志 你看就行了 出现新信息会自动往下走

如果出现一堆如这样的信息

2:49:47 (ansyslmd) EXITING DUE TO SIGNAL 37 Exit reason 5

22:49:47 (lmgrd) ansyslmd exited with status 37 (Communications error)

22:49:47 (lmgrd) Since this is an unknown status, license server

22:49:47 (lmgrd) manager (lmgrd) will attempt to re-start the vendor daemon.

22:49:47 (lmgrd) REStarted ansyslmd (internet tcp_port 35772 pid 15078)

22:49:47 (ansyslmd) FLEXnet Licensing version v11.9.1.1 build 93024 x64_lsb

22:49:47 (ansyslmd) Server started on linux for:        ans_rdpack

22:49:47 (ansyslmd) acfx_solveracfx_nolimit a_jt_reader        a_proe_reader

22:49:47 (ansyslmd) a_spaceclaim_catv5 amesh_tgrid        acfd_polyflow_solver

22:49:47 (ansyslmd) amesh_extended        ane3fl                ane3flds

22:49:47 (ansyslmd) ane3fl1                ane3fl2                ane3fl3

22:49:47 (ansyslmd) ane3fldp        ansys                ane3

22:49:47 (ansyslmd) anfl                ansysds                ane3ds

22:49:47 (ansyslmd) anflds                ansysdp                ane3dp

22:49:47 (ansyslmd) anfldp                ancfx                struct

22:49:47 (ansysl

22:49:57 (ansyslmd) tebach                aunivres        anstoken

22:49:57 (ansyslmd) perfpar                zdysmp                wcfstrh

22:49:57 (ansyslmd) vprfnls                ustcfx                tancfx

22:49:57 (ansyslmd) rcfstr2                icfstr1                cfstru

22:49:57 (ansyslmd) hcfstru                gfppp                cconcif

22:49:57 (ansyslmd) aconcatia        struct1                struct2

22:49:57 (ansyslmd) struct3                apei                cfstred

22:49:57 (ansyslmd) anlsczfd0        ansysul                ansysed

22:49:57 (ansyslmd) anaux15                anaux12                anpst26

22:49:57 (ansyslmd) anpst1                ansol                anpr7

22:49:57 (ansyslmd) ansysrf                ansysuh                cae4samcef

22:49:57 (ansyslmd) cae4nastran        cae4abaqus        anshpc_pack

22:49:57 (ansyslmd) aice_solv        aice_par        aice_pak

22:49:57 (ansyslmd) aice_opt        aice_mesher        acpreppost

22:49:57 (ansyslmd) acfd_polyflow_extrusion acfd_polyflow_blowmolding acfd_polyflow

22:49:57 (ansyslmd) acfd_mhd        a_spaceclaim_dirmod

22:49:57 (ansyslmd) EXTERNAL FILTERS are OFF

几乎就可以了  现在你在运行你那个友好的配置界面看看3个服务是不是都已经启动了

如果上面两个服务没有启动  没关系  你直接点 左边的Startx the ansys 启动它就可以了

然后在去命令下面重启一下 lmgrd 服务 就是这个命令./lmgrd -c ../license.dat -l ../license.log

如果还是有些服务起不来

你就输入 ps -aux |grep lmgrd 命令 来查看进程  把lmgrd进程杀掉

所有的步骤有些时候可能需要改变顺序 可以慢慢试 可以启动95%的ansys 除非有其他意外是我没注意到的

在求助的时候 我希望你们好好检查你们的配置,不要犯低智商的错误,也请你们把你们的排错的过程写下来 这样方便我们判断问题的所在。

本人技术不高,只是耐心与细致,就可以解决大部分错误,如果可以希望你先百度一下,可以简单的去解决你的问题,比如如何更改网卡的名字。

到这里了,祝你们万事顺利吧。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值